**Job Summary**

**What is the opportunity?**

RBC Group Advantage is a comprehensive business segment that offers a variety of retirement savings products including Group RRSP’s, Deferred Profit Sharing Plans, and Pooled Retirement Pension Plans that are combined with expert advice and delivered in the convenience of the workplace.

If you are a self-motivated professional who enjoys building relationships with business clients and thrives on putting clients first, you will enjoy this mobile consultant and advice role focused on the delivery of the Group Retirement Savings value proposition to commercial/corporate clients. This is an important role to all RBC business platforms and offers a variable compensation plan.

**What will you do?**
- Anchor clients to Group Retirement Savings and Financial Wellness programs: 60% of your time will be focused on lead generation and 40% on sales activation
- Identify referral opportunities for the Mortgage Assistance and Capital Loan Programs
- Champion the RBC Group Advantage value proposition with partners and in the external market
- Build and maintain relationships with senior managers across Canadian Personal and Commercial Banking and Wealth Management
- Enable activities that result in the acquisition of new Group Advantage Sponsors
- Be flexible to work an occasional evening or weekend

**What do you need to succeed?**

**Must-have**
- Strong prospecting, networking and business development skills
- Excellent relationship building skills both internally and externally to identify and implement strategies that drive business growth
- Independent, entrepreneurial and self-management skills to achieve planned goals
- Experience creating a referral network and a current, extensive network of “centres of influence”
- Designation as a Retirement Plans Associate (RPA) and/or Certified Employee Benefit Specialist (CEBS) through the International Foundation of Employee Benefit Plans or be willing to complete the necessary courses to achieve the RPA designation within 18 months of start date

**Nice-to-have**
- Excellent presentation, communication, time management and organizational skills
- Highly developed PC and mobile literacy with demonstrated digital capability using Microsoft Office products (Excel, Word, Power point)
- Action oriented and creative business acumen
